Opportunity is a very useful skill as long as the card that has it has at least one requirement: good speed.


Skill Definition Opportunity: the monster with this ability can attack the opposing card from any position it is in and will hit the enemy monster with the lowest salute.

The cards that possess this ability do not have a greeting and a high defense, especially if they are at level 1. This characteristic therefore makes them very vulnerable and it is necessary to place them in the right position.

In my case, I used the SERPENTINE SPY card, UNTAMED card of the fire sign, currently at level 2, and you can see how the greeting is extremely precarious with only 1 life point.

Conclusions

Never deploy a card with Opportunity ability in the first or last position because you risk being immediately eliminated, especially if it has very low life points!
